Maritime flashpoints: Taiwan Strait and South China Sea
Key Questions
What recent military drills has China conducted near Taiwan?
China's 'Justice-2025' drills involved 130 aircraft and live-fire exercises. Taiwan responded with rare simultaneous live-fire drills and tested US-supplied HIMARS rockets toward the mainland.
What gray-zone tactics is China using in the Taiwan Strait?
Chinese vessels entered prohibited waters around Taiping Island and the Pratas Islands for the first time. These short incursions were expelled by Taiwan's coast guard, escalating harassment beyond routine patrols.
How has China responded to the Philippines in the South China Sea?
China sanctioned Philippine Defense Chief Gilberto Teodoro and his family over maritime disputes. It also installed a new floating structure at Scarborough Shoal, prompting Philippine protests.
What new naval capabilities is China developing?
China's navy is deploying a new 155mm naval gun system for cost efficiency. It continues island-building at Antelope Reef and jamming operations against foreign vessels.
Are there signs of de-escalation in US-China military talks?
The US and China held rare military talks amid ongoing tensions. However, PLA activities including air-defense tests facing Taiwan continue to heighten risks in the region.
